The timeless sequel to the Kate Greenaway Medal and Kurt Maschler Award-winning 'Alice's Adventures in Wonderland'. For over a century, Lewis Carroll's classic stories of logic and lunacy have inspired delight in young and old alike. Continuing Alice's adventures, 'Alice Through the Looking-Glass' sees her walking through a mirror into a topsy-turvy world. There she meets a host of bizarre characters, including Tweedledum and Tweedledee, Humpty Dumpty and the Red Queen. But is it all a dream?;'An Alice for the new millennium, this book is a triumph of design and rare quality.'
